An invoice is a detailed list of goods shipped or services rendered, with an account of all costs - an itemized bill. A job invoice is an invoice detailing work that has been done. Alabama Invoice Template for Firefighter is a professional document specifically designed to create invoices for fire service providers in Alabama. This template helps firefighters accurately bill their clients for the services rendered systematically while adhering to the specific requirements of invoicing in Alabama. The Alabama Invoice Template for Firefighter includes all the essential elements necessary for a comprehensive, detailed, and legally compliant invoice. It typically includes the following information: 1. Header: The top section contains the firefighter's name, contact details, logo (if applicable), and the term "Invoice" prominently displayed. 2. Invoice Number: Each invoice is sequentially numbered to help in unique identification and record-keeping purposes. 3. Invoice Date: The date on which the invoice is issued is mentioned to establish the billing period. 4. Client Details: The template provides space to enter the client's name, address, and contact information. It ensures accurate delivery of the invoice and aids in maintaining a professional relationship. 5. Fire Services Details: This section allows the firefighter to itemize and describe the services performed. It includes information such as the date of service, description of the service, the number of hours worked, equipment used (if any), and any additional charges or discounts applied. 6. Billing Terms: Here, the payment terms, due date, and accepted payment methods are clearly stated. Additionally, any late fees or penalties for delayed payments can be detailed. 7. Subtotal and Taxes: The subtotal is calculated by summing up the charges for each service provided. State and local sales taxes are applied, where applicable, as per Alabama regulations. 8. Total Amount Due: The total amount due is the sum of the subtotal and any taxes, including any adjustments for discounts or added fees. This clearly indicates the total payment expected from the client. 9. Payment Instructions: The invoice template may contain specific instructions on how to remit the payment, including the mailing address or bank account information for electronic transfers. 10. Notes or Additional Information: This section allows for the inclusion of any additional details or special instructions relevant to the invoice. Different types of Alabama Invoice Templates for Firefighters may exist to cater to specific needs or situations. Some possible variations of this template include: 1. Hourly Rate Invoice Template: This template focuses on recording the number of hours worked by the firefighter and multiplying it by the predetermined hourly rate to calculate the charges. 2. Flat Rate Invoice Template: This template is designed for situations where firefighters charge a fixed amount for specific services rendered, irrespective of the time spent. 3. Retainer Agreement Invoice Template: This template is used when a firefighter has a retainer agreement with a client, detailing a fixed fee for providing fire services over a specified period. 4. Emergency Response Invoice Template: This template is specifically tailored for firefighters providing emergency response services. It may include additional sections such as mileage expenses, equipment used, or emergency response fees. These Alabama Invoice Templates for Firefighters help streamline the invoicing process, ensure accurate billing, increase professionalism, and improve financial management for fire service providers in Alabama.
